Overview

Zhi Ping Xu is a researcher affiliated with the University of Queensland in Australia. Their work primarily spans the fields of Engineering and Materials Science, with extensive contributions in several interconnected subfields such as Materials Chemistry, Biomedical Engineering, Molecular Biology, Immunology, and Oncology.

Their research topics include a focus on nanotechnologies and biomedical applications, covering areas such as:

  • Nanoplatforms for cancer theranostics
  • RNA Interference and Gene Delivery
  • Immunotherapy and Immune Responses
  • Nanoparticle-Based Drug Delivery
  • Advanced biosensing and bioanalysis techniques
  • Advanced Nanomaterials in Catalysis
  • Advanced Photocatalysis Techniques
